The paper under review deals with a quasilinear perturbation, through the mean curvature flow operator, of the classical linear heat equation. The main result establishes a necessary and sufficient condition for the existence of a positive solution. Next, it is shown that the solution is unique and is symmetric around \(1/2\). The asymptotic behaviour of this solution is also studied. The final section analyzes the dynamics of solutions and proposes some open problems.
